Bellevue, WA—(February 9, 2010) The Parent Coaching Institute (PCI) proudly hosts a workshop titled "What Makes Us Feel 'At Home'?" presented by Roni Stein, Ed.D, PCI Certified Parent Coach®, on Friday, March 5th from 8:30 am until 4:00 pm at the Bellefield Office Park Conference Center in Bellevue, WA. The fee for this day-long workshop is $95 and includes breakfast and lunch. This workshop, open to the public, explores key ribbons of culture that run through our daily lives. The conversation will focus on how these unique dimensions of culture impact us, our clients, our families, and the communities we live in. Knowing about these underlying key dimensions of culture can enhance the work of family support professionals such as teachers, parent educators, counselors, social workers, doctors, and nurses, as well as provide awareness to parents who have adopted children internationally and to couples who come from different cultures. Certain kinds of relationships and environments along with ways of approaching change and decision-making are all impacted by one's cultural background. The classic work of Geert Hofstede will be used to shed light on the many unexpected culturally-based issues that inevitably come up in our lives. There will be lots of potential for "aha" moments. The recent disaster in Haiti and the frequent news headlines about international adoptions highlight the need for understanding cultural differences and the effects of relocating a child from their established culture to a new culture during the process of adoption. Margann Duke, MS, PCI Certified Parent Coach® and mother of internationally adopted children, states, "When parents have a cultural understanding, the attachment process is enhanced, and behavioral challenges can be reframed. There's a gift of cultural richness when you're raising children from other cultures. When we have this cultural understanding, we can provide a unique source of empathy and support to help parents integrate children from other cultures into their families." Attendees of the workshop "What Makes Us Feel 'At Home'?" will be better prepared to respect cultural differences and address the cultural issues that arise when raising an internationally adopted child.

About The Parent Coaching Institute

The Parent Coaching Institute (PCI™) is a 501(c)(3) non-profit organization with an international following and the originator of the parent coaching profession. The PCI™, founded by Gloria DeGaetano in 2000, continues to set the highest standards for parent coaching certification. Using the PCI™ innovative coaching model, graduates co-create with parents solutions to parenting challenges, leading to new levels of family fulfillment.
